Herz-Jesu-Kirche, Neo-Romanesque parish church in Mayen, Germany.
The church features twin bell towers reaching 43 meters high, with a central nave extending 50 meters in length and 15 meters in height.
The church, built between 1911 and 1912, underwent reconstruction in 1952 after substantial damage during World War II on January 2, 1945.
The church maintains its position as a protected cultural monument in Mayen, forming part of the Deanery of Mayen-Mendig within the Diocese of Trier.
The structure stands adjacent to the medieval city walls of Mayen and beneath the Genovevaburg, integrating with the historical district layout.
The building includes five towers in its architectural layout, incorporating both medieval and neo-Romanesque design elements in its construction.
